from pathlib import Path
from app.hands.interface import IHands
class SandboxHands(IHands):
"""Limited capabilities: workspace only, MCP allowed, no browser"""
def __init__(
self,
workspace_root: str = "~/.eigent/workspace",
allowed_mcps: frozenset[str] | None = None,
) -> None:
self.workspace_root = Path(workspace_root).expanduser()
# None = allow all MCP (default for debug override); frozenset() = allow none
self.allowed_mcps = allowed_mcps
@property
def mode(self) -> str:
return "sandbox"
def can_execute_terminal(self) -> bool:
return (
True # Enabled; toolkit layer validates against command allowlist
)
def can_access_filesystem(self, path: str) -> bool:
try:
resolved = Path(path).expanduser().resolve()
workspace = self.workspace_root.resolve()
resolved.relative_to(workspace)
return True
except ValueError:
return False
except (OSError, RuntimeError):
return False
def can_use_mcp(self, mcp_name: str) -> bool:
if self.allowed_mcps is None:
return True # MCP available in all cases
if not self.allowed_mcps:
return False
return mcp_name in self.allowed_mcps
def can_use_browser(self) -> bool:
return False # No browser hand in limited mode
def get_working_directory(
self, session_id: str, tenant_id: str = "default"
) -> str:
return str(self.workspace_root / session_id)
def get_capability_manifest(self) -> dict[str, str | bool | list[str]]:
return {
"mode": self.mode,
"terminal": self.can_execute_terminal(),
"browser": False,
"filesystem": "workspace_only",
"mcp": "all" if self.allowed_mcps is None else "allowlist",
"mcp_allowlist": []
if self.allowed_mcps is None
else list(self.allowed_mcps),
"deployment": "override_sandbox",
"workspace_root": str(self.workspace_root),
}
def acquire_resource(
self, resource_type: str, session_id: str, **kwargs
) -> str:
raise ValueError(
f"Resource type {resource_type!r} is not available in sandbox mode"
)
def release_resource(self, resource_type: str, session_id: str) -> None:
return None
